Using Bridge Font in Canva

Canva is a fantastic platform for non-designers and professionals alike. Here’s how to use Bridge Font in Canva:

  1. Upload the Bridge Font to Canva by going to the “Uploads” tab and selecting the font file
  2. Select the text element on your design and choose the Bridge Font from the font dropdown menu
  3. Experiment with OpenType features and glyphs by using Canva’s built-in font editor

Using Bridge Font in Adobe Photoshop and Illustrator

For more advanced design work, Adobe Photoshop and Illustrator are industry standards. Here’s how to use Bridge Font in these platforms:

  1. Install the Bridge Font on your computer by following the font’s installation instructions
  2. Open Adobe Photoshop or Illustrator and select the text tool
  3. Choose the Bridge Font from the font dropdown menu and adjust the font settings as needed
  4. Access OpenType features and glyphs by using the “Window” > “Type” > “Glyphs” menu

Using Bridge Font in Microsoft Word

For more straightforward design projects, Microsoft Word is a great option. Here’s how to use Bridge Font in Word:

  1. Install the Bridge Font on your computer by following the font’s installation instructions
  2. Open Microsoft Word and select the text element
  3. Choose the Bridge Font from the font dropdown menu and adjust the font settings as needed

Frequently Asked Questions

Q A
What is Bridge Font best used for? Bridge Font is ideal for display purposes, such as posters, flyers, banners, and luxury branding.
Is Bridge Font suitable for body text? No, Bridge Font is not recommended for body text or smaller font sizes, as it can become too ornate.
Can I use Bridge Font for commercial projects? Yes, Bridge Font can be used for commercial projects, but be sure to check the font’s licensing terms and conditions.
Does Bridge Font support OpenType features? Yes, Bridge Font supports OpenType features, glyphs, and stylistic alternates, giving you plenty of creative freedom.
